Abstract

This utility model relates to the field of cooling device technology and discloses a deep water cooling device for a data center reservoir. It includes a bottom plate, with support plates fixedly connected to both sides of the top of the bottom plate. The data center body is installed inside the data center shell. Cooling water coils are installed on both sides and the top of the inner wall of the data center shell. An anti-scaling component, a cooling mechanism, and a water pump are installed in the middle of the top of the bottom plate. A filter component is installed on the left side of the top of the bottom plate, and a water source pipe is installed on the left side of the filter component. By incorporating the filter component and the anti-scaling component, and through the filter screen, multi-stage filtration of the water source can be achieved, removing sediment particles. The anti-scaling component contains cation exchange resin to reduce the content of calcium and magnesium ions in the water source, preventing scaling. This avoids the problems of blockage and scaling inside the cooling device, which affect the cooling effect and the service life of the device.
